java.util.zip-GZIPInputStreamクラス
前書き
ザ・ java.util.zip.GZIPInputStream クラスは、GZIPファイル形式で圧縮データを読み取るためのストリームフィルターを実装します。
クラス宣言
以下はの宣言です java.util.zip.GZIPInputStream クラス-
public class GZIPInputStream
extends InflaterInputStream
田畑
以下はのフィールドです java.util.zip.GZIPInputStream クラス-
protected CRC32 crc −非圧縮データの場合はCRC-32。
protected boolean eos −入力ストリームの終了を示します。
static int GZIP_MAGIC −GZIPヘッダーのマジックナンバー。
コンストラクター
シニア番号 | コンストラクターと説明 |
---|---|
1 | GZIPInputStream(InputStream in) デフォルトのバッファサイズで新しい入力ストリームを作成します。 |
2 | GZIPInputStream(InputStream in, int size) 指定されたバッファサイズで新しい入力ストリームを作成します。 |
クラスメソッド
シニア番号 | 方法と説明 |
---|---|
1 | void close()
この入力ストリームを閉じて、ストリームに関連付けられているシステムリソースを解放します。 |
2 | int read(byte [] buf、int off、int len)
圧縮されていないデータをバイトの配列に読み込みます。 |
継承されたメソッド
このクラスは、次のクラスからメソッドを継承します-
- java.util.zip.InflaterInputStream
- java.io.FilterInputStream
- java.lang.Object